What's the best time of year to travel to Abidjan with my pet?
When you’re travelling with pets, keeping track of the weather can make the trip saf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ually April and March, with an average temperature of 28°C, while the coldest months are August and September, with an average of 25°C. The rainiest months in Abidjan are June, May, October and November, with each month seeing an average of 265 mm of rainfall.
